Build More with Your Career at Christman


Are you interested in becoming an employee-owner with a leading national general contractor that will provide you with opportunities to Build More in your professional career? The Christman Company is looking for a dynamic Human Resources Manager in the Livonia, Michigan region.


In your role as Human Resources Manager, you will have the opportunity to lead all facets of human resources in partnership with a people-focused executive team. You will partner with business leaders across all regions to develop and execute HR strategies focused on talent management, talent acquisition, compensation, and supporting company policies and practices. In addition, you will create and manage programs and projects that will collaborate and partner with the broader HR team.


What You Will Do


As Human Resources Manager, your primary daily responsibilities of this role include, but are not limited to:


  • Partners with the leadership team to understand and execute the organizations human resource and talent strategy particularly as it relates to current and future talent needs and recruiting.
  • Performs other duties as assigned.
  • Provides support and guidance to employees, management, and other partners when complex, specialized, and sensitive questions and issues arise; may be required to administer and execute routine tasks in delicate circumstances such as providing reasonable accommodations, investigating allegations of wrongdoing, and terminations.
  • Maintains compliance with federal, state, and local employment laws and regulations, and recommended best practices; reviews policies and practices to maintain compliance.
  • Partners with managers to facilitate employee disciplinary meetings, terminations, and investigations.
  • Manages the talent acquisition process, which may include recruitment, interviewing, and hiring of qualified job applicants, particularly for managerial, exempt, and professional roles; collaborates with departmental managers to understand skills and competencies required for openings.
  • Maintains job descriptions ensuring they are up-to-date, accurate and compliant with relevant federal, state and local laws for all positions.
  • Maintains knowledge of trends, best practices, regulatory changes, and new technologies in human resources, talent management, and employment law.

Why Christman?


Here at Christman, everyone is an owner. Through our employee stock ownership plan, each employee-owner shares in the collective success and wealth of our nationally recognized company and is eligible to participate in our comprehensive benefits program, including health insurance, 401K contribution, professional development and tuition reimbursement, and more.


We're a top 100-ranked ENR General Contractor that has been building since 1894. Learn more about how you can grow as a Christman Expert, Leader and Partner and build more with us.
